  • Midsommar, directed by Ari Aster and starring Florence Pugh, is now streaming on Netflix UK/IE. Here are the mind-blowing hidden details in the film explained and analysed. Watch. Your. Back.
    0:00 - 0:12 - Introduction
    0:13 - 1:11 - Foreshadowing
    1:12 - 1:36 - The Flower Crown
    1:37 - 2:05 - Dani's Family
    2:06 - 2:48 - Bear Imagery
    2:49 - 3:46 - Skin the Fool
    3:47 - 5:04 - Unsettling Audio Tricks
    5:05 - 6:08 - Reflections Everywhere
    6:09 - 7:15 - Triangles
    7:16 - 9:03 - The Number 9

    Here's something I noticed:
    Dark colours are used to represent darkness while pastel colours represent hiding that darkness. In the U.S before they go to Sweden all the scenes take place in dark rooms and all of the characters wear dark clothing symbolising that they don't hide their darkness from other people. On the first day at the commune Dani wears a pastel t-shirt bc she is hiding her grief and the people in the cult are also wearing pastel bc they are hiding the true horrors of the commune from the visitors. The only places that are dark in the commune are inside the buildings because that's where the wall paintings showing the gruesome fates of the characters are.

    If you are familiar with the Elder Futhark runes, you would find a whole other level of meaning in the various scenes. From the embroidery on their costumes to the murals and even the structural elements of the buildings. Especially when the camera shot is dominated by a single element, like the x-shape of the communal table or the giant mallet the old man is holding. It’s a communication at a whole other level.

    • @Fururu333
      @Fururu333 년 전 +1

      What do they mean? Please tell us.

    • @ingridcornwell4341
      @ingridcornwell4341 년 전 +15

      Well, for example, at 0:04 and at 2:46, you see Dani and Christian in the traditional dress. You’ll notice there is a diamond shape in blue that is the rune Ingwaz🔹in the Elder Futhark that represents “Seed”. They are the future generation in this ritual. Dani’s costume is the only girl’s costume with this shape. And Christian has impregnated the girl that chose him and possibly others before his death. (There are other runes within these shapes with additional meanings relating more specifically to male & female roles.)At 0:59 even the structure the group walks through is a giant Ingwaz 🔹at the back while at 1:06, from the front, the structure resembles a rising sun - hence the dawn of the new generation. I do wonder if the old couple who jumped to their deaths were perhaps once united in a previous ritual and that perhaps one day Dani and Pelle will be expected to end their lives in the same ritualized manner. There are so many, many more connections if you’ll explore the Elder Futhark runes and their meanings. It really is very fascinating.
